Pete Buttigieg, Democratic mayor of South Bend, Indiana, recently announced he has formed an exploratory committee to consider a run for the presidency in 2020. Only 37 years old and with no federal government experience, Buttigieg might seem an unlikely candidate. He sits down with Judy Woodruff to discuss tax policy, his new book and why he believes his generation's voices aren't being heard.
